He visto a demasiados integradores perder horas conduciendo a sitios remotos solo para extraer manualmente metraje de una tarjeta SD. Ese problema termina con Perfil G1.
Sí, nuestras cámaras PTZ 4G de grado industrial admiten completamente la reproducción remota desde la tarjeta SD a través de ONVIF Perfil G. Esto significa que su VMS puede buscar, recuperar y reproducir grabaciones almacenadas en el borde sin que nadie visite el sitio. El Perfil G también permite el relleno automático de huecos después de interrupciones de red, por lo que nunca se pierde metraje.

El Perfil G no es solo una casilla de verificación en una hoja de especificaciones. Es la columna vertebral de almacenamiento en el borde2 en videovigilancia profesional. A continuación, le explicaré exactamente cómo funciona con nuestras cámaras, qué trampas evitar y cómo obtener el mejor rendimiento a través de un enlace 4G.
Índice
¿Puedo usar la línea de tiempo de mi NVR para buscar metraje grabado almacenado en el borde de la cámara?
Si alguna vez ha mirado fijamente una línea de tiempo en blanco en su NVR sabiendo que la cámara grabó localmente, comprende la frustración. El metraje está ahí. Simplemente no puedes acceder a él.
Puedes. Cuando tanto la cámara como su NVR o VMS admiten el Perfil G, la línea de tiempo del NVR mostrará todas las grabaciones almacenadas en la tarjeta SD de la cámara. Puede buscar, buscar por rango de tiempo y reproducir clips directamente, al igual que el metraje almacenado localmente en el propio NVR.

Cómo funciona el descubrimiento de la línea de tiempo
Cuando su NVR se conecta a nuestra cámara a través de ONVIF, envía una ObtenerResumenGrabacion3 o una solicitud FindRecordings. La cámara responde con una lista de todos los segmentos de grabación disponibles en la tarjeta SD. Su NVR luego mapea estos segmentos en su propia línea de tiempo.
Esto no es magia. Es un apretón de manos estructurado. La cámara mantiene una base de datos de índice interna de cada archivo grabado. Cada entrada incluye una hora de inicio, una hora de finalización y un tipo de pista (video, audio o metadatos). Cuando el NVR pregunta “¿qué tienes entre las 2:00 AM y las 6:00 AM?”, la cámara consulta su índice y responde con los segmentos exactos.
Por qué el índice importa más de lo que crees
Aquí es donde muchas implementaciones fallan silenciosamente. Si el índice de archivos de la tarjeta SD está corrupto —a menudo causado por una pérdida repentina de energía o una tarjeta barata— la cámara no puede responder a la consulta del NVR. La línea de tiempo no muestra nada. Las grabaciones existen en la tarjeta, pero son invisibles para el Perfil G.
Por eso recomendamos encarecidamente tarjetas SD de grado industrial de alta resistencia4 formateadas en exFAT5. Estas tarjetas manejan los ciclos constantes de lectura/escritura de la grabación de vigilancia mucho mejor que las tarjetas de consumo.
| Factor | Tarjeta SD de consumo | Tarjeta SD industrial de alta resistencia |
|---|---|---|
| Ciclos de escritura | ~1,000 | ~30,000+ |
| Protección contra pérdida de energía | No | Sí |
| Temperatura de funcionamiento | 0°C a 32°C | -25°C a 85°C |
| Recomendado para Perfil G | No | Sí |
| Vida útil típica (grabación 24/7) | 3–6 meses | 2–3 años |
Sincronización horaria: el asesino silencioso
No puedo enfatizar esto lo suficiente. Si el reloj de la cámara y el reloj del NVR no están sincronizados, la línea de tiempo parecerá rota. El NVR solicita grabaciones a las 3:00 PM hora del servidor. La cámara las grabó a las 3:02 PM hora de la cámara. ¿El resultado? El NVR cree que no se grabó nada durante esa ventana.
Siempre fuerce la sincronización NTP6 en todos los dispositivos. Utilice un único servidor NTP fiable. Para implementaciones en Norteamérica, time.nist.gov funciona bien. Establezca el intervalo de sincronización en no más de cada 60 minutos. Una deriva de 30 segundos es suficiente para causar fallos en la búsqueda en el Perfil G.
Consejo práctico para el caso de uso de David
Si está desplegando cámaras solares en sitios remotos de Texas, probablemente administre docenas de cámaras desde un VMS central. Asegúrese de que su nivel de licencia de VMS realmente incluya la reproducción en el borde del Perfil G. Algunas licencias de nivel de entrada, incluso de proveedores importantes como Milestone, restringen esta función a niveles más altos. Verifique antes de implementar, no después.
¿La conexión del Perfil G sobrevivirá a una señal 4G de bajo ancho de banda durante la reproducción?
He probado la reproducción a través de enlaces 4G que apenas alcanzaban 1 Mbps. No es bonito, pero funciona, si lo configura correctamente.
Sí, la conexión del Perfil G sobrevivirá a las señales 4G de bajo ancho de banda. Nuestro firmware admite la reproducción de doble flujo, por lo que puede elegir el subflujo para una recuperación fluida en conexiones débiles. La sobrecarga de señalización del Perfil G es mínima y los datos de video reales se adaptan al ancho de banda disponible.

Comprensión de las matemáticas del ancho de banda
La reproducción del Perfil G es esencialmente una transmisión de video RTSP7 activada por un comando ONVIF. La parte de señalización (las consultas de búsqueda, los comandos de reproducción/pausa/detención) utiliza muy poco ancho de banda. Generalmente menos de 10 Kbps. La parte pesada es la transmisión de video en sí.
Aquí es donde el soporte de doble flujo se vuelve crítico:
| Tipo de flujo | Resolución | Bitrate | Velocidad 4G mínima necesaria |
|---|---|---|---|
| Corriente principal | 1080p / 2MP | 4-6 Mbps | 6+ Mbps (estable) |
| Subflujo | D1 / CIF | 256–512 Kbps | 0,5 Mbps |
| Corriente principal | 4MP | 6-8 Mbps | 8+ Mbps (estable) |
En una conexión 4G típica en un área rural, podría obtener 2–5 Mbps en un buen día. Eso es suficiente para la reproducción del subflujo, pero es arriesgado para el flujo principal. Mi recomendación: use el subflujo para una revisión rápida y para desplazarse por la línea de tiempo. Cuando encuentre el clip que necesita, programe una descarga del flujo principal durante las horas de menor actividad (más sobre esto a continuación).
Manejo de latencia y fluctuación
Las redes 4G tienen tiempos de ida y vuelta (RTT) más altos que las conexiones por cable. El RTT típico en 4G es de 30 a 80 ms, pero puede aumentar a más de 200 ms en celdas congestionadas. Los comandos de reproducción rápida del Perfil G (avance rápido, retroceso, búsqueda) dependen de una señalización oportuna. Si un comando de búsqueda tarda 200 ms en llegar a la cámara y otros 200 ms para la respuesta, notará un retraso visible al desplazarse por la línea de tiempo.
La configuración del búfer es tu aliada
La mayoría de las plataformas VMS le permiten establecer un tamaño de búfer de reproducción. Para implementaciones 4G, recomiendo establecerlo en al menos 3–5 segundos. Esto absorbe los picos de fluctuación sin causar que la reproducción se entrecorte o se congele. Sí, agrega un pequeño retraso cuando presiona reproducir por primera vez. Pero evita el patrón constante de inicio-parada-inicio que hace que la revisión remota sea dolorosa.
¿Qué sucede cuando se cae completamente el 4G?
La sesión del Perfil G caducará. Cuando la conexión regrese, su VMS necesitará restablecer la sesión RTSP. La mayoría de las plataformas VMS modernas manejan esto automáticamente. La cámara no pierde ningún dato; sigue grabando en la tarjeta SD independientemente del estado de la red. Las imágenes estarán allí cuando se reconecte.
¿Cómo me aseguro de que los archivos de video se indexen correctamente para una búsqueda rápida a través de ONVIF?
He depurado más tickets de “imágenes faltantes” de los que puedo contar. Nueve de cada diez veces, las imágenes están en la tarjeta. El índice simplemente está roto.
Para garantizar una indexación correcta, utilice una tarjeta SD de grado industrial formateada en exFAT, habilite la grabación programada en la configuración local de la cámara, mantenga una sincronización horaria NTP estricta y evite retirar la tarjeta sin desmontarla primero. Estos cuatro pasos evitan la gran mayoría de los fallos de búsqueda del Perfil G.

Cómo la cámara crea su índice
Cada vez que la cámara escribe un segmento de video en la tarjeta SD, también escribe una entrada de índice correspondiente. Esta entrada contiene:
- Marca de tiempo de inicio (basado en el reloj de la cámara)
- Marca de tiempo de finalización
- Ruta del archivo en la tarjeta SD
- Tipo de pista (video, audio, metadatos)
- Tipo de grabación (continuo, activado por evento, alarma)
Cuando su VMS envía un EncontrarGrabaciones o ObtenerResultadosDeBusquedaDeGrabaciones comando, la cámara lee este índice, no los archivos de video reales. Por eso la velocidad de indexación es importante. Un índice saludable en una tarjeta de 256 GB con semanas de metraje debería responder en menos de 2 segundos. Un índice corrupto podría tardar 30 segundos o simplemente no devolver nada.
Las Cuatro Reglas de la Indexación Fiable
Regla 1: Formatee la tarjeta dentro de la cámara, no en un PC. Nuestro firmware crea la estructura de directorios y las tablas de índice correctas durante el formateo. Si formatea en un PC, la cámara podría no reconocer la disposición de la partición.
Regla 2: Nunca retire la tarjeta mientras la cámara está grabando. Esta es la causa número uno de corrupción del índice. Si debe retirar la tarjeta, detenga la grabación primero y luego use la interfaz web para desmontarla de forma segura.
Regla 3: Habilite el modo “sobrescribir cuando esté lleno”. Cuando la tarjeta SD se llena, la cámara necesita eliminar archivos antiguos y actualizar el índice. Si el modo de sobrescritura está deshabilitado, la cámara simplemente deja de grabar cuando la tarjeta está llena, y algunas plataformas VMS interpretan esto como “no hay grabaciones disponibles”.”
Regla 4: Supervise la salud de la tarjeta a través de los metadatos del Perfil G. Nuestras cámaras exponen métricas de salud de la tarjeta SD a través de ONVIF. Su VMS puede leer la capacidad de almacenamiento restante, el recuento total de errores de lectura/escritura y el estado de la tarjeta. Configure alertas en su VMS para marcar cualquier cámara donde la tarjeta SD muestre errores o caiga por debajo del 10% de espacio libre.
Cuándo sospechar un problema de índice
| Síntoma | Causa probable | Fijar |
|---|---|---|
| La línea de tiempo no muestra grabaciones | Índice corrupto o tarjeta no formateada | Reformatee la tarjeta en la cámara, vuelva a habilitar la grabación |
| La línea de tiempo muestra huecos que no deberían existir | Deriva NTP entre la cámara y el VMS | Forzar sincronización NTP, verificar configuración de zona horaria |
| La reproducción comienza pero se congela a mitad del clip | Sectores defectuosos en la tarjeta SD | Reemplazar la tarjeta con una unidad de grado industrial |
| La búsqueda tarda más de 10 segundos | Inflación del índice por meses de uso | Reformatear la tarjeta y reiniciar el ciclo de grabación |
| El VMS muestra grabaciones pero no puede reproducirlas | Fragmentos de archivo por pérdida de energía | Habilitar respaldo UPS o supercondensador en la cámara |
Una nota sobre los formatos de archivo
Nuestras cámaras graban en estándar .mp4 contenedores con codificación H.264 o H.265. El Perfil G espera formatos de contenedor estándar. Algunas cámaras de otros proveedores utilizan formatos propietarios .dav o .hik que requieren complementos específicos del proveedor. Nuestro enfoque mantiene las cosas simples: archivos estándar, protocolos estándar, máxima compatibilidad.
¿La cámara admite la “descarga masiva” de metraje a través del Perfil G durante las horas de menor actividad?
Descargar horas de metraje HD a través de 4G durante el horario comercial es una mala idea. Consume su plan de datos y ralentiza el monitoreo en vivo. Hay una mejor manera.
Sí, nuestras cámaras admiten la descarga masiva de metraje grabado a través del Perfil G. Puede configurar su VMS para programar transferencias de archivos grandes durante las horas de menor actividad, generalmente entre la medianoche y las 5 AM, cuando la congestión de la red 4G es menor y los costos de datos pueden reducirse. Este es el enfoque recomendado para la recuperación de evidencia de calidad forense a través de enlaces celulares.

Cómo la descarga masiva difiere de la reproducción en vivo
La reproducción en vivo a través del Perfil G transmite el video en tiempo real. Lo ves mientras se reproduce. La descarga masiva, a veces llamada “replicación sin interrupciones” o “sincronización de borde a servidor”, es diferente. El VMS solicita un rango de tiempo específico y descarga los archivos de video sin procesar tan rápido como la conexión lo permite. No necesitas verlo en tiempo real. El VMS almacena los archivos descargados en su propio servidor para su revisión posterior.
Esta distinción es importante porque la descarga masiva puede utilizar todo el ancho de banda disponible sin preocuparse por la fluidez de la reproducción. Si su enlace 4G le proporciona 3 Mbps a las 2 AM, el VMS extraerá datos a 3 Mbps continuamente hasta que la transferencia se complete.
Configuración de la sincronización programada
La mayoría de las plataformas VMS empresariales admiten sincronización programada de borde8. Aquí está el flujo de trabajo general:
- Definir la ventana de sincronización. Establecer horas de inicio y fin (por ejemplo, de 00:00 a 05:00).
- Seleccionar cámaras. Elegir qué cámaras deben sincronizarse durante esta ventana.
- Establecer prioridad. Si tiene 20 cámaras compartiendo un servidor VMS, escale los tiempos de sincronización para evitar abrumar la capacidad de ingesta del servidor.
- Elegir tipo de flujo. Para evidencia forense, sincronice el flujo principal. Para revisión general, el subflujo ahorra ancho de banda y almacenamiento.
- Habilitar modo de relleno de huecos9. Esto le indica al VMS que detecte automáticamente cualquier hueco en su propia línea de tiempo de grabación y extraiga solo los segmentos faltantes de la tarjeta SD de la cámara.
Relleno de huecos: la característica más infravalorada
El relleno de huecos es el verdadero poder del Perfil G en implementaciones 4G. Este es el escenario: su señal 4G se interrumpe durante 45 minutos durante una tormenta. La cámara sigue grabando en la tarjeta SD. Cuando la señal regresa, el VMS detecta un hueco de 45 minutos en su propia línea de tiempo. Envía automáticamente una solicitud de Perfil G a la cámara: “Dame todo de 14:15 a 15:00”. La cámara transmite esos archivos al VMS. El hueco desaparece.
Sin intervención manual. Sin visitas técnicas. Sin evidencia perdida.
Para los sitios solares de David en Texas, esto no es un "agradable tener". Es un requisito del proyecto. Sus clientes finales —ya sean operadores de campos petroleros o agencias municipales— esperan una grabación continua. El relleno de huecos a través del Perfil G cumple esa promesa incluso cuando el enlace 4G no es confiable.
Consideraciones del plan de datos
La descarga masiva de metraje a través de 4G consume datos. Una sola cámara grabando a 2 Mbps genera aproximadamente 900 MB por hora. Si necesita sincronizar 8 horas de metraje perdido, son alrededor de 7 GB por cámara. Multiplique por 10 cámaras y estará viendo 70 GB en un ciclo de sincronización.
Trabaje con su proveedor de telefonía celular para obtener un plan de datos que admita transferencias masivas fuera de horas pico. Algunos operadores ofrecen tarifas con descuento para el uso de datos durante la noche. Considere también establecer un límite de datos diario por cámara en su VMS para evitar costos descontrolados si una cámara se desconecta durante días e intenta sincronizar todo a la vez.
Conclusión
El Perfil G convierte la tarjeta SD de su cámara en un archivo totalmente accesible y buscable de forma remota. Empareje esto con la sincronización NTP, tarjetas SD industriales y el relleno de huecos programado —y su implementación 4G se volverá tan confiable como un sistema cableado.
1. Especificación oficial para ONVIF Profile G, que estandariza el almacenamiento en el borde y la reproducción remota. ︎↩︎ 2. Descripción general de los conceptos y beneficios del almacenamiento en el borde en sistemas de vigilancia. ︎↩︎ 3. Especificación ONVIF WSDL para el comando GetRecordingSummary utilizado para descubrir grabaciones en el borde. ︎↩︎ 4. Línea de tarjetas SD industriales de Western Digital diseñada para grabación continua y condiciones extremas. ︎↩︎ 5. Especificación del sistema de archivos Microsoft exFAT, adecuado para tarjetas SD grandes en vigilancia. ︎↩︎ 6. Preguntas frecuentes de NTP que explican cómo funciona la sincronización de tiempo y su importancia para la precisión de las marcas de tiempo. ︎↩︎ 7. RFC 7826 para RTSP 2.0, el protocolo utilizado para la transmisión de video en la reproducción del Perfil G. ︎↩︎ 8. Artículo de la base de conocimientos de Honeywell sobre la programación de la sincronización en el borde para dispositivos de almacenamiento remoto. ︎↩︎ 9. Artículo de Axis Communications que explica el relleno automático de huecos para grabaciones de almacenamiento en el borde. ︎↩︎